Mel Preibisch
Melvin Aloysius Preibisch "Primo"
Born: November 23, 1914
Sealy, TX US
Deceased: April 12, 1980
Sealy, TX US
Primary Position: Outfield
Bats: Right
Throws: Right
Height: 5'11"
Weight: 185
Career: 1936-1941
Major League Statistics
Mel Preibisch compiled a career batting average of .293 with 23 home runs and 0 RBI in his 480-game career with the Waterloo Hawks, Savannah Indians, Knoxville Smokies, Albany Senators, Hartford Bees and Evansville Bees. He began playing during the 1936 season and last took the field during the 1941 campaign.
